ChemInform Abstract: The iso-Tetraphosphane P(P(SiMe3)(C6H5))3.
Abstract
The preparation of the title compound (III) from PCl3 (I) and the Li phosphide (II) requires two steps: at -78 °C PCl3 (I) reacts with two equiv. (II) without side reactions; at -35 °C the formed intermediate (Ph(Tms)P)2PCl reacts with the third phosphide (II) to yield (III) quite cleanly.

The results of a NMR investigation of (III) are reported.
